How to fill out community fund policy

01
To fill out a community fund policy, start by reviewing the purpose and goals of the community fund. Understand why it exists and what it aims to achieve.
02
Identify the key stakeholders involved in the community fund. This could include community leaders, residents, organizations, and a fund management team. Consider their perspectives and incorporate their input while filling out the policy.
03
Determine the eligibility criteria for accessing the community fund. Decide who can apply for funding and the specific requirements they need to meet. This could include residency, project alignment with community goals, or financial need.
04
Establish a clear application process. Define the necessary documentation, forms, and deadlines for submitting funding requests. Provide guidance on how applicants should present their project proposals and budgets.
05
Define the evaluation and selection process for funding requests. Outline the criteria that will be used to assess applications and allocate funds. This could include factors such as project feasibility, impact on the community, and alignment with fund objectives.
06
Specify the decision-making process for approving or rejecting funding requests. Determine who will be responsible for reviewing applications, making final decisions, and communicating outcomes to applicants.
07
Develop clear guidelines for monitoring and evaluating funded projects. Outline the reporting requirements and expectations for recipients of community fund assistance. Establish regular check-ins to track project progress and assess the impact of funded initiatives.
08
Consider the financial management aspects of the community fund policy. Define how funds will be allocated, tracked, and audited. Establish protocols for handling any surplus funds or unexpected expenses.
09
Communicate the community fund policy effectively. Ensure that all stakeholders, including potential applicants and community members, are aware of the policy's existence and its guidelines. Make the policy easily accessible through various channels, such as websites or community notice boards.
